Rocky Mountain is 1-6 against Owyhee since April of 2022 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Saturday. The Rocky Mountain Grizzlies will square off against the Owyhee Storm at 5:00 p.m. Both teams come into the match b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
Rocky Mountain is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Friday. They came out on top against Mountain View by a score of 10-6. The win made it back-to-back victories for Rocky Mountain.
Rocky Mountain got a great performance from Colby Chambers as he pitched 5.1 innings while giving up just two earned (and three unearned) runs off seven hits. Chambers has been consistent recently: he hasn't tossed less than five strikeouts in five consecutive pitching appearances.
At the plate, Jeff Thompson was incredible, scoring a run while going 3-for-4. Another player making a difference was Javin Ellett, who scored two runs while getting on base in three of his four plate appearances.
Meanwhile, Owyhee entered their tilt with Lake City with 16 cons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with 17. They won by a run and slipped past the Timberwolves 3-2.
Hunter Mahaffey looked comfortable as he pitched four innings while giving up just two earned runs off five hits.
On the hitting side, Owyhee saw six different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Nathan Keith, who got on base in three of his five plate appearances with a double.
Rocky Mountain has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won nine of their last ten contests, which provided a nice bump to their 19-8 record this season. As for Owyhee, their win bumped their record up to 23-2.
